MightyE tells you, "Legend of the Green Dragon is a remake of and homage to the classic BBS Door game, Legend of the Red Dragon (aka LoRD) by Seth Able Robinson."

"LoRD is now owned by Gameport (), and they retain exclusive rights to the LoRD name and game.

That's why all content in Legend of the Green Dragon is new, with only a very few nods to the unique game, such as the buxom barmaid, Violet, and the handsome bard, Seth."

"Although serious effort was made to preserve the authentic feel of the game, numerous departures were taken from the original game to enhance playability, and to adapt it to the web."

"LoGD (after version ) is released under a Resourceful Commons License, which essentially means that the source code to the game, and all derivatives of the game must stay open and available upon seek.

Version and before are still available under the GNU General Public License though will be the last release under that license. To use any of the new features requires using the code. You may explicitly not place code from versions after into and release the combined derivative work under the GPL."
